What's Happening?
Arshdeep Singh, a fast bowler for India, reached a significant milestone by becoming the first Indian bowler to take 100 wickets in Twenty20 cricket. This achievement occurred during India's match against Asia Cup newcomer Oman, where India secured a victory by 21 runs. The match took place in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ates. Arshdeep's milestone wicket was taken in the final over, helping to restrict Oman to 167-4. India had earlier scored 188-8, experimenting with its batting order in preparation for its upcoming Super 4 game against Pakistan. Key performances included Sanju Samson's 56 runs and Abhishek Sharma's 38 runs. Despite the absence of key bowlers Jasprit Bumrah and Varun Chakravarthy, India managed to secure the win.
